Spoons Cafe owner Karen Klassen opened The Garage Sept. 28 in what used to be the cafe's overflow seating, located at 100 E. Louisiana St., McKinney.

"[The space] was functioning as a backup dining room to Spoons and I saw at nighttime the business had changed so much so the back room wouldn’t fill up," Klassen said. "We always filled up during the weekends and at lunch during the week but at the nighttime I had all this empty space in the back and I saw what was going on and the transition of downtown McKinney. And I really felt the need for a place to do a quieter venue, [and] still serve some really good comfort foods in smaller portions and some really great craft cocktails for the grownup Spoons people."

The Garage serves menu items from Spoons Cafe during regular cafe hours in addition to craft cocktails and "comfort cups." One example of a comfort cup is baked spaghetti with garlic toast served in a glass.

The newly renovated space also offers a lounge area available for private cocktail parties.

The new space is open for guests ages 18 and older until 9 p.m. when The Garage becomes a space for those ages 21 and older. The Garage is open Monday-Thursday from 11:30 a.m.-10 p.m.; Friday from 11:30 a.m.-11 p.m.; Saturday from 8:30 a.m.-11 p.m. and Sunday from 8:30 a.m.-10 p.m.
